When Is It Time to Upgrade Your Old Air Conditioner?
Recognizing when it is time to improve can prevent dollars in the end. Here are some signals:
1. Age of Your Unit
Most air-con contraptions last approximately 10–15 years. If yours is nearing this age, it will possibly be time to recall a new one.
2. Rising Energy Bills
Have you saw a spike in your power costs? An inefficient unit consumes extra electrical energy, which can suggest it’s time for an improve.
three. Frequent Repairs
If you uncover your self characteristically calling for AC restoration services, this is able to be a signal that your unit is on its closing legs.
4. Inconsistent Temperatures
Are distinct regions in your property warmer or cooler than others? This inconsistency would imply your AC is absolutely not functioning competently.
5. Increased Humidity Levels
An valuable air conditioner have to diminish humidity tiers indoors. If you feel sticky despite the AC strolling, it may possibly lack efficiency.
6. Noise Levels
Is your air conditioner making unusual noises? Unusual sounds can suggest mechanical problems which can require expensive maintenance or warrant substitute.
Estimating Costs and Budgeting for an Upgrade
Upgrading an air-con unit is additionally dear, however figuring out what to expect helps budget effectively.

1. Average Costs of New Units
Depending on the type and brand of AC unit you decide on, rates can range considerably:
| Type | Estimated Cost (CAD) | |------------------------|-----------------------| | Central Air Conditioning| $3,000 - $7,000 | | Ductless Mini-Split | $2,000 - $5,500 | | Window Units | $150 - $600 | | Portable Units | $two hundred - $800 |
2. Installation Fees
Don’t put out of your mind about installation expenses! Depending on complexity, professional installing can check any place from $400 to $1,2 hundred.

Choosing the Right Size of AC Unit for Your Space
One common query owners ask is: “What measurement of AC unit do I desire?” The reply lies in quite a few components:
1. Square Footage of Your Home
The dimension of your own home broadly impacts the size of the AC unit required. Generally communicating:
- Up to 500 sq toes: 1 ton 500–one thousand sq toes: 1–2 tons 1000–1500 sq toes: 2 tons
Use this as a starting point; consulting with execs is recommended for certain calculations.
2. Ceiling Height
Higher ceilings require extra cooling chronic; take this into account whilst figuring out length requirements.
